A Corrsin type approximation for Lagrangian fluid Turbulence

In Lagrangian turbulence one is faced with the puzzle that 2D Navier-Stokes flows are nearly as intermittent as in three dimensions although no intermittency is present in the inverse cascade in 2D Eulerian turbulence. In addition, an inertial range is very difficult to detect and it is questionable whether it exists at all. Here, we investigate the transition of Eulerian to Lagrangian probability density functions (PDFs) which leads to a new type of Lagrangian structure function. This possesses an extended inertial range similar to the case of tracer particles in a frozen turbulent velocity field. This allows a connection to the scaling of Eulerian transversal structure functions.
